Background technology
Electromagnetic relay be it is a kind of using electromagnetic force drive mechanical part relative motion and produce the relay of predetermined response, It is generally made of iron core, coil, armature, yoke, sound reed with contact etc..Electricity is produced when passing through electric current in coil Magnetic force, armature are attracted, so that the stationary contact point contact of the movable contact of movable contact spring and static contact spring piece;When current vanishes in coil When, electromagnetic force disappears therewith, and armature resets, so that the movable contact of movable contact spring is separated with the stationary contact of static contact spring piece, by dynamic The actuation of contact and stationary contact separates, and achievees the purpose that on or off circuit.
For traditional AUTOMOTIVE RELAY when assembling diode, diode is normally mounted at coil and the position in the middle part of pedestal Put, it is necessary to resistance be made " [" shape, the dimensional uniformity of shaping are difficult to ensure that assembly difficulty is big, low production efficiency.Diode Connection with coil terminals needs each one-off around, consumption scolding tin, produce welding flue gas, makees by the way of scolding tin, spot welding Industry environment is poor, and technique realizes that difficulty is larger, it is impossible to meets automated production needs;And the coil terminals of left and right two are using symmetrical Structure, it is impossible to it is general, production management difficulty is added, production cost is high.
